October 20, 2011 BIR RULING NO. 387-11 Sec. 101 (A) (3) of the Tax Code of 1997; BIR Ruling No. DA-(DT-015) 161-09; BIR Ruling No. DA-(DT-068) 725-09 Mabalacat Baptist Church, Inc. 119 McArthur Hi-way, Mamatitang Mabalacat, Pampanga Attention: Edwin C. Cordero Corporate Secretary Gentlemen : This refers to your letter dated May 20, 2011 requesting exemption from the payment of donor's tax over a parcel of land donated by the Philippine Baptist S.B.C., Inc. in favor of the Mabalacat Baptist Church, Inc. It is represented that the Philippine Baptist S.B.C., Inc. with Tax Identification Number 002-563-757-000 is the owner of a parcel of land located at Mamatitang, Mabalacat, Pampanga covered by TCT No. 121476-R issued by the Registry of Deeds for the Province of Pampanga and containing an area of eight hundred ninety four (894) square meters; that on the other hand, the Mabalacat Baptist Church, Inc. with Tax Identification Number 007-913-318-000 is a religious corporation duly organized and existing under the laws of the Philippines and registered with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) under SEC Registration No. CN201017821; and that on May 12, 2011, a Deed of Donation was executed whereby the donor transfers and conveys eight hundred sixty (860) square meters of the subject property. In reply-thereto, please be informed that inasmuch as the donee is a religious corporation, the aforementioned donation is exempt from the payment of donor's tax pursuant to Section 101 (A) (3) of the Tax Code of 1997, subject to the condition that not more than 30% of said gift shall be used by the donee for administration purposes. aACHDS Moreover, the Deed of Donation is not subject to documentary stamp tax. However, the acknowledgment on said deed is subject to the documentary stamp tax of P15.00 imposed under Section 188 of the Tax Code of 1997, as amended. (BIR Ruling No. DA-S30-017-2002 dated July 23, 2002). This ruling is being issued on the basis of the foregoing facts as represented. However, if upon investigation it will be disclosed that the facts are different, then this ruling shall be considered null and void. Very truly yours, (SGD.) KIM S. JACINTO-HENARES Commissioner of Internal Revenue
